Oyo: I Will Go After APC Chieftains That Stole N15bn – Makinde

Governor of Oyo State, Seyi Makinde, has vowed to probe the immediate past administration of the All Progressives Congress (APC), for allegedly stealing about N15 billion from the state treasury.

The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) governor, who stated this on Saturday while speaking on a Splash 105.5 FM programme cherished “State Affairs”, accused the APC members of using a certain company to siphon between N12 and N15 billion of the State’s money.

Makinde expressed his administration’s determination to retrieve every kobo looted by the APC members.

According to him: “Let me give you an example – when I came in, I looked at how some monies were spent and I believed it was Paris Club refund they moved, which was about N7 billion to N8 billion to OYSROMA.

“There is a company called Chinese Global. They said they are Chinese people but we know the people behind it. The company has been shut down as we speak.

“I asked the General Manager in charge of OYSROMA and said, look, your budget is N44 Million every month and, in a year, it is less than N500 million. Did you employ new people? He said no. Did you give out contracts? He said no. But how were you able to spend about N7 Billion in eleven months without employing new people?

“The money is in excess of N12 billion to N15 billion. Those who stole it are not Chinese but from Oyo State. “We know them, and very soon, wherever they have investment or property in the world, I will go after them and collect this money for our state”
